Geri and I arrived at Hotel Batha after a 16 hour journey and met up with Phil this morning. We hired a guide, Sayeed, to take us into the souk , the labarynth of shops and stalls surrounding the Medina because it is so big and maze like that tourists usually get lost. WOW. It was really amazing! There were people selling: figs; nuts; leather; fabric; copper pots. There were very narrow paths where people would be trying to get by each other and then a donkey would come down the path loaded with leather or spices. They put car tire rubber on the donkey's hooves for traction on the cobble stone. The people here have been so friendly and helpful. No chaos here so far, no one trying to pick our pockets or making lewd comments (Geri and I trying not to take this too personally!) We have been invited to our Guide's house tonight for dinner, so we bought some figs and bread to bring over. They are in Ramadan now, so they do not eat or drink anything, including water, from sunrise to sunset. Everyone shares their food with us here; the man on the train shared his bread and yogurt. They will take your food in return, I gave the man my candy, and Geri gave him a power bar. We are going to Marrakech tomorrow and will use it for a base camp for our camel trek to the Sahara.
